companyBRM AI logo

Junior Software Engineer at BRM | San Francisco

BRM AISan Francisco Office
On-site Full-time

Clicking Apply Now takes you to AutoApply where you can tailor your resume and apply.


Unlock Your Potential

Generate Job-Optimized Resume

One Click And Our AI Optimizes Your Resume to Match The Job Description.

Is Your Resume Optimized For This Role?

Find Out If You're Highlighting The Right Skills And Fix What's Missing

Experience Level

Entry Level

Qualifications

Required Skills: Proficiency in TypeScript, NodeJS, PostgreSQL, and Redis. Preferred Skills: Familiarity with cloud services like GCP and experience with containerization technologies such as Docker.

About the job

Empowering the Buyer

At BRM, we are on a mission to equip individuals with the essential tools to excel in their work. Our innovative digital assistants simplify the process of tool management for companies, making tasks such as contract renewals, document retrieval, negotiation, and compliance reviews seamless and efficient. With BRM’s technology, we are putting the power back in the hands of the buyers!

Junior Software Engineer

Why Join Us? We are at a transformative stage with a roadmap full of potential. We are seeking enthusiastic junior engineers and recent graduates who are ready to learn, grow, and contribute to pioneering AI-driven solutions. Collaborate with seasoned engineers to enhance the inbox experience, streamline legal and finance workflows, and empower our AI assistants. This is an excellent opportunity for hands-on learning through the development of real features that add significant business value while honing your skills in modern technologies and best practices. We prioritize curiosity, enthusiasm, and a strong desire to create an impact over mere experience.

Key Responsibilities

  • Work with senior engineers to design, develop, and maintain software solutions utilizing TypeScript, NodeJS, PostgreSQL, Redis, and cutting-edge AI technologies.

  • Learn and implement best practices in code quality, testing, and documentation while contributing to production-level features.

  • Engage in code reviews, technical discussions, and planning meetings to accelerate your learning and provide fresh insights.

  • Take ownership of well-defined features and tasks, receiving mentorship and support to ensure your success.

  • Acquire practical experience with cloud services (GCP), containerization (Docker), and contemporary development workflows.

  • Collaborate with cross-functional teams to understand the impact of engineering decisions on product and business outcomes.

Your Profile

  • Education & Experience: Recent graduate (within the last 3 years) holding a degree in Computer Science, Engineering, or a related field, with at least one internship, significant class project, or demonstrable coding experience through personal projects or open-source contributions.

  • Dedication: Passionate about the chance to work alongside experienced developers and accelerate your career trajectory. You understand that rapid learning demands commitment and are ready to invest the time to enhance your skills.

About BRM AI

BRM is a forward-thinking technology company dedicated to enabling organizations to efficiently manage their tools and resources. Our mission is to empower buyers by providing innovative digital solutions that streamline complex processes and enhance productivity.

Similar jobs

Tailoring 0 resumes

We'll move completed jobs to Ready to Apply automatically.